The Essential Role of Dehumidification in Indoor Comfort

Dehumidification is a vital process that removes excess moisture from the air, creating a more comfortable indoor environment. When humidity levels rise, the air feels warmer, leading to a sense of discomfort even at lower temperatures. Excess moisture can trigger a range of physiological responses, including increased perspiration and an overall feeling of heaviness. By effectively lowering humidity, air conditioning systems enhance the perception of coolness and comfort, making indoor living spaces more enjoyable.

Furthermore, high humidity can lead to the proliferation of mold and mildew, which pose serious health risks. Mold thrives in damp environments, and its spores can trigger allergic reactions, respiratory issues, and other health complications. By integrating efficient dehumidification into the air conditioning process, homeowners can reduce the risk of mold growth, thus safeguarding their well-being and promoting healthier living conditions. This aspect of indoor air quality cannot be understated; a dehumidified environment is not only comfortable but also conducive to health.

Finally, effective dehumidification plays a significant role in protecting home furnishings and structural integrity. High humidity levels can damage wooden furniture, promote rust on metal appliances, and warp structural elements of the home. By controlling humidity, air conditioning systems help preserve the lifespan of household items and maintain the aesthetic appeal of a home. In essence, dehumidification is an indispensable component that contributes to holistic indoor comfort and protection.

Why Air Conditioning Systems Must Prioritize Humidity Control

Air conditioning systems must prioritize humidity control to deliver optimal performance and energy efficiency. When humidity levels are high, air conditioning units must work harder to cool the air, leading to increased energy consumption and higher utility bills. By focusing on effective dehumidification, homeowners can improve the efficiency of their systems, allowing for lower operational costs while maintaining comfort. This not only benefits residential budgets but also reduces strain on energy resources, contributing to a more sustainable environment.

Moreover, prioritizing humidity control can significantly enhance the durability of air conditioning systems themselves. Excess moisture can lead to corrosion and wear on critical components, leading to frequent repairs or premature system failure. A well-maintained system with proper humidity control is less likely to encounter operational issues, extending the lifespan of the appliance and ensuring reliable performance for years to come. Homeowners who invest in dehumidifying features are not only preserving their comfort but also safeguarding their financial investment.

In addition, modern air conditioning systems are designed with advanced technology that incorporates humidity control as a critical feature. Systems equipped with variable speed compressors, multi-stage cooling, or integrated dehumidifiers provide more precise control over indoor humidity levels. By embracing these sophisticated systems, homeowners can enjoy a balanced indoor climate that supports both comfort and a healthy living environment. Ultimately, giving priority to humidity control within air conditioning systems is not merely a luxury; it is a necessity for achieving optimal indoor conditions.
